Artistic Details
- The Aesthetic: Two meticulously carved bottle forms are positioned on dark, geometric shelves, creating a sharp contrast against the vibrant, textured red acrylic background.
- 3D Depth: Utilising a mixed technique of inlay-wood sculpture and painting, the three-dimensional elements physically project from the base to create a sense of architectural depth.
- Craftsmanship: Every component is made from recycled offcuts wood, painstakingly sanded to a smooth finish to highlight the unique character of the wood grain.
